Digital Transformation

Educause, a nonprofit association and the largest community of technology, academic, industry, and campus leaders advancing higher education through the use of IT, argued that digital transformation is the future of higher education. To support institutional digital transformations, Educause developed a number of resources (see below).


Digital transformation is a series of deep and coordinated culture, workforce, and technology shifts that enable new educational and operating models and transform an institution's business model, strategic directions, and value proposition.

Brown, M., Reinitz, B., & Wetzel, K. (2020). 


Digital technology development includes three stages: Digitisation, Digitalisation and Digital transformation (Fig. 1).

Fig. 1: Stages of Digitisation (adapted from Brown et al, 2022).

Digital transformation requires strong leadership and commitment. Educause has mapped out a number of processes to support the institutional digital transformation (a Dx journey) that includes learning, planning and doing.

Introduction:
A digital transformation strategy should strategically position itself to take advantage of the digital economy and to better prepare students and employees for this digital age. Therefore, to better understand current practices it is necessary to develop an analytic framework. The framework needs to include analyses of current digital platforms and student and employee learning. While there are numerous approaches to teaching and learning, there are only two meta-theories: instruction and construction (cognitive and social). Instruction is based on behaviourism, while constructivism is concerned with learning through experience (Table 1).

Table 1: Attributes of behaviourism and constructivism .

Constructivism

Behaviourism

Cognitive

Social

View of knowledge Knowledge is a repertoire of behavioural responses to environmental stimuli. Knowledge systems of cognitive structures are actively constructed by learners based on pre-existing cognitive structures. Knowledge is constructed within social contexts through interactions with a knowledge community.
View of learning Passive absorption of a predefined body of knowledge by the learner. Promoted by repetition and positive reinforcement. Active assimilation and accommodation of new information to existing cognitive structures. Discovery by learners is emphasised. Integration of students into a knowledge community. Collaborative assimilation and accommodation of new information.
View of motivation Extrinsic, involving positive and negative reinforcement. Intrinsic; learners set their own goals and motivate themselves to learn. Intrinsic and extrinsic. Learning goals and motives are determined both by learners and extrinsic rewards provided by the knowledge community.

Expansive Learning

Any theory of learning must answer at least four central questions: (1) Who are the subjects of learning, how are they defined and located?; (2) Why do they learn, what makes them make the effort?; (3) What do they learn, what are the contents and outcomes of learning?; and (4) How do they learn, what are the key actions or processes of learning? (p. 133)

Standard theories of learning are focused on processes where a subject (traditionally an individual, more recently possibly also an organization) acquires some identifiable knowledge or skills in such a way that a corresponding, relatively lasting change in the behaviour of the subject may be observed. It is a self-evident presupposition that the knowledge or skill to be acquired is itself stable and reasonably well defined. There is a competent "teacher" who knows what is to be learned. The problem is that much of the most intriguing kinds of learning in work organizations violates this presupposition. People and organizations are all the time learning something that is not stable, not even defined or understood ahead of time. In important transformations of our personal lives and organizational practices, we must learn new forms of activity which are not yet there. They are literally learned as they are being created. There is no competent teacher. (pp. 137-138)

Engeström (2001)


Engeström’s four questions: Who is learning? Why do they learn? What do they learn? How do they learn? Authentic Assessment


Activity 2: Authentic Assessment

Suggested time:
20 minutes

Introduction:
Assessment is most effective when it reflects an understanding of learning as multi-dimensional, integrated, and revealed in performance over time. Learning is complex process. It entails not only what students know, but what they can do with what they know; it involves not only knowledge and abilities, but values, attitudes, and habits of mind that affect both academic success and performance beyond the classroom. Assessment should reflect these understandings by employing a diverse array of methods, including those that call for actual performance, using them over time so as to reveal change, growth and increasing degrees of integration

 Traditional versus authentic Assessment .

Traditional

Relies on indirect or proxy items

Reveals only whether students can recognise, recall or ‘plug in’ what was learned out of context

Conventional tests are usually limited to pencil-and-paper, one-answer questions

Conventional tests typically only ask the student to select or write correct responses - irrespective of the reasons

Traditional testing standardises objective ‘items’ and the one ‘right’ answer for each





Authentic

Direct examination of student performance on worthy intellectual tasks

Requires students to be effective performers with acquired knowledge

Present the student with a full array of tasks

Attend to whether the student can craft polished, thorough and justifiable answers, performances or products

Achieves validity and reliability by emphasising and standardising the appropriate criteria for scoring varied products

‘Test validity’ should depend in part upon whether the test simulates real-world ‘tests’ of ability

Involves ill-structured challenges that help students rehearse for the complex ambiguities of professional life

Learning Design Principles


To understand what constitutes quality teaching, we need to first think about how people learn. Various learning theorists from Lev Vygotsky to Yrjo Engestrom posit that people learn best by being actively involved in the learning process, in particular, by engaging with authentic activities and solving real-life problems in a social context, i.e. working collaboratively. The approach presented here is therefore one which promotes authentic learning.

The five key questions, each with a number of elements and criteria, provide, a framework which models a process that can be used to design and evaluate contact, online and blended teaching and learning. 

Fig. 1: Five questions to guide learning design and evaluation.

What you will do:

Use the five questions to evaluate the learning design that is reflected in the authentic learning research article that you have read and briefly write your findings in the space provided below each of the questions.

1. Where do we start?
The first question in the design framework requires you to take a step back and ask big-picture questions, such as: What is the context? Who are the target group? 
  • Are contextually appropriate design decisions about the student target audience, language backgrounds, socio-economic contexts of students, profiles and abilities of students, venues, access to transport, resources and facilities, timing, clustering and grouping and mode of provision considered?
  • Is learning linked to real-life contexts in which learners live and work?


2. What do learners need to learn… and how do they learn it?
The second question in the design/evaluation process takes a closer look at content and how it is presented in order to support learning, i.e. the underpinning pedagogical approach.
  • Is the purpose, outcomes, content (including nature of activities) and assessment aligned?
  • Is the content well sequenced and scaffolded?
  • Is the content provided accurate, up-to-date, relevant, content free of discrimination?
  • Is the content knowledge presented as changing and debatable, rather than fixed and unquestionable?
  • Are authentic activities or sets of activities integrated across outcomes /topics?
  • Do they provide learners with appropriately complex, integrated and diverse problems to solve?


3. How can we support learners to succeed?
The third question in the design/evaluation framework ties together context and content by looking at how learning activities serve to mediate learning and engage learners in meaningful dialogue and reflection?
  • Are the activities appropriate for the learning pathway and assessment strategy?
  • Does the learning design motivate learners engaging them in meaningful dialogue using reflection and feedback from others on activities to guide their thinking?
  • Does the learning design provide learners with a range of opportunities for meaningful discussion and communication and collaborative engagement with their peers? As well as with more knowledgeable others where appropriate?
  • Where appropriate, complement the written text with visual and other accessible multi-media?
  • Is technology used to support communication, collaboration and mediate learning (not just to disseminate information)?



4. How will we know learners have learned?
The fourth question focuses on identifying opportunities for assessment in activity-based learning and integrating formative tasks.
  • Is assessment integrated into teaching and learning? i.e. formative assessment for learning?
  • Does the assessment design shift assessment practice from a focus on testing what learners know, mainly by way of recalling the content learnt, to applying knowledge and skills in a real-world context?
  • Are learners required to perform real-world tasks that demonstrate meaningful application of essential knowledge and skills?
  • Are assessment tasks contextualised, enabling the learners to demonstrate (provide evidence of) their competency in a learner-structured, authentic setting?



5. How can we ensure quality teaching and learning?
The fifth question asks you to reflect on and evaluate the learning design with the view to adapting or strengthening it.


  • Does the learning design invite and create a structured opportunity for reflection or ask for feedback from the learners?

Authentic Learning Principles (Technology-mediated learning programme framework)

Amiel and Reeves (2008) suggested two positions related to the use of ICTs in the classroom: The power of technology to change pedagogical practices, and the use of computers as tutors with no human intervention. Earlier, Reeves et al. (2004)   suggested that learning environments should include authentic tasks that:
  • Have real-world relevance.
  • Are ill-defined/imprecise and include a number of sub tasks.
  • Are complex and require students to undertake complex investigations.
  • Provide opportunities for students to investigate the tasks from different perspectives.
  • Provide collaborative opportunities.
  • Include integrated assessment.
  • Yield possible products that include more than one iteration.
  • Allow competing answers or solutions.
